Lot Description

A silver plated snuff box, of crescent form having engraved nautical star and foliate decoration with personal dedication for 'Captn. Norie, S.S. Maywood 1910', to the hinged cover. Length measures 3 4/8 inches (9 cm).

Displaying heavy wear and rubbing throughout with general scratching and few small dints. Hinge in working order and interior with heavy wear.
